Accessory Dwelling Unit (ADU) design and construction compliant with California ADU laws (SB 9, SB 68, SB 1123). EDR Design Build provides turnkey ADU solutions including architectural design optimized for code compliance, permitting coordination with local jurisdictions, construction management, and final inspection. ADUs serve as guest houses, in-law quarters, rental income properties, or long-term housing solutions. Typical ADU sizes 400-800 sq ft with project costs ranging from $150K-$400K depending on configuration and finish levels.

Previous railings were about 2'-0" tall with oversize spacing and rust. The new railings were brought up to code with 36" tall top bar and maximum 4" openings. The finish was a mahogany brown powder coat over hot-dip galvanizing to protect from rust in the long-term.

FRUIT FOREST
With prior establishment of plum and pear trees and raspberries, transforming the expansive lawn into a perennial fruit haven was a sensible and resilient decision for the home owner. Berries were planted into 80 linear feet of hugelkultur mounds, layered with tree trimmings, leaves, manure, and mulch, to provide long term fertility. Fruit trees established an orchard to provide fruit from August through October.
Plant List:
Blueberries
Apple Trees
Cherry Trees
Apricot Tree
Currants
Jostaberries
Gooseberries
Aronia
Cranberry Viburnum

A gut remodel of the lower level of this beach home was needed when the client’s husband, a retired marine biologist and avid surfer, was diagnosed with early Alzheimer’s. The master suite with spa bath/shower wet room, and guest bedroom with full bath were redesigned for a whole new look and for better efficiency of the space to prepare for long term care while aging in place.
